📊Reference tables

Rig style Typical droppers Spacing range Bottom clearance Calculator bias
Hi-low surf rig218-30 in / 46-76 cm8-14 in / 20-36 cmWider in wash
Paternoster boat rig2-418-34 in / 46-86 cm10-18 in / 25-46 cmDepth balanced
Sliding ledger rig1-220-36 in / 51-91 cm12-22 in / 30-56 cmLow hook start
River bottom rig2-322-38 in / 56-97 cm12-24 in / 30-61 cmCurrent margin
Deep reef rig3-524-42 in / 61-107 cm16-28 in / 41-71 cmLonger ladder
Sabiki-style bait rig4-68-16 in / 20-41 cm6-12 in / 15-30 cmCompact arms
Target group Feeding zone Bait swing Spacing preference Bottom hook note
Panfish / baitfishLow-midSmallCompactKeep close to sinker
Pompano / whitingLowModerateMediumAbove rolling sand
Flounder / flatfishVery lowModerateMedium-lowBottom dropper starts low
Walleye / perchLow-midModerateMediumProtect from snags
Sea bass / scupMid-lowQuick biteMedium-wideUse even ladder
Catfish / cut baitBottomLargeWideBig bait needs gap
Snapper / grouperReef edgeLargeWideLift from rocks
Rockfish / codDeep bottomLargeWideAllow drop and drift
Material Sweep factor Spacing adjustment Tangle behavior Best use
Monofilament leader1.00BaselineAverage coil memoryGeneral bottom rigs
Fluorocarbon leader0.92+1 in / +3 cmDense and directClear water rigs
Stiff mono / amnesia0.78-2 in / -5 cmStands away wellSurf and pier rigs
Braided branch line1.18+5 in / +13 cmLimp and wraps easilyShort bait arms only
Light wire snood0.70-3 in / -8 cmStiff but visibleToothy fish rigs
Coated wire snood0.74-2 in / -5 cmControlled swingHeavy bait rigs
Twisted dropper loop0.86-1 in / -3 cmBetter stand-offBoat bottom rigs
T-bar or stand-off boom0.62-4 in / -10 cmStrong separationDeep multi-hook rigs
Line angle Current feel Spacing addition Bottom margin addition Practical effect
0-8 degVertical0-2 in / 0-5 cm0-1 in / 0-3 cmClean drop
9-18 degLight sweep2-5 in / 5-13 cm1-3 in / 3-8 cmMost boat drifts
19-30 degModerate sweep5-10 in / 13-25 cm3-6 in / 8-15 cmWider bait arcs
31-45 degStrong sweep10-16 in / 25-41 cm6-10 in / 15-25 cmUse fewer droppers
46+ degHard sweep16+ in / 41+ cm10+ in / 25+ cmShorten rig or add weight

Tip: If the spacing is less than twice the snood length, shorten the snood first. That usually fixes hook-to-hook wraps without making the whole leader excessive.

Tip: In strong current, keep the lowest hook high enough that bait swing does not tap the sinker or bottom on each lift of the rod tip.

Most folks completely forget about the swing radius. If you hang a snood straight down in a pool, it occupy zero lateral space. Once current hits it, however, that line begin sweeping out an arc. That arc have a finite size and if you space your dropper lines narrower then said arc, they’re going to intersect eventually.

This tool considers this because it includes how far off-vertical your line happens to be. Fifteen degrees may not sound like much, but it make a huge difference in terms of increasing the sweep zone. What the calculator does is adjust the center-to-center spacing needed to keep those arcs from overlapping. That’s why hooks gets wrapped around one another: it’s all about overlap.

It’s not just about dropping line. It’s controlling a three dimensional volume of water. Surprisingly, one element that plays a part are material stiffness. Limp fluorocarbon or braid will drape and blow around, requiring extra space to breathe. Stiffer mono or amnesia stay off the main line and keeps things tight. This reduces the swing radius and lets you get by with closer spacing.

These coefficients is laid out on page’s reference grid. You can see how T-bar boom holds the bait away rigidly from leader and effectively eliminates swing. In heavy current, the choice of a stiffer material can be the difference between a clean presentation and a ruined leader. It’s a small mechanical advantage that builds up over a long session.

Tangles are inevitable, not random events; they’re a consequence of insufficient spacing compared to your droppers’ length. In moderate current, your center-to-center distance should be at least twice the length of your snood (for example, if your snood is 12 inches long, stay at 24 inches or more). Your tangle risk score reflects this ratio. It’s a red flag you see before tying the knot.

High score? Your rig is too dense for the conditions. The solution: Either increase the gap between them or decrease the snood length. Both lower the odds of a collision.
